Maison > Article > Opération et maintenance > Comment vérifier l'état du service sous Linux
1. Utilisez le processus pour vérifier
Utilisez la commande :
ps -aux | grep xxx
pour vérifier si un processus ou un service existe .
Partager des didacticiels vidéo en ligne : Tutoriels vidéo Linux
2. Utilisez la commande services
1. un seul service Statut :
service 服务名 status
Tel que :
[root@localhost ~]# service sshd status openssh-daemon (pid 3701) 正在运行…
2. Afficher l'état d'exécution de tous les services :
service –status -all
3. Utilisez l'outil de configuration chkconfig
(Il n'y a pas de commande chkconfig dans Ubuntu, vous pouvez utiliser update-rc.d à la place. La commande update-rc.d dans les systèmes Ubuntu ou Debian est un script utilisé pour mettre à jour les éléments de démarrage du système. Le les liens vers ces scripts se trouvent dans le répertoire /etc/rcN.d/, et le script correspondant se trouve dans le répertoire /etc/init.d/ Avant de comprendre la commande update-rc.d, vous devez connaître le démarrage principal. étapes du système Linux et la connaissance du niveau d'exécution dans Ubuntu.)
1. Vérifiez l'état d'exécution d'un seul service :
chkconfig 服务名 status
2. tous les services
chkconfig –list
3. Fermez ou activez le service Statut :
chkconfig –level 345 nscd off/on
4. Ajoutez un service :
chkconfig –add xxx
(Remarque : Le le script de service doit être stocké dans le répertoire /etc/init.d/)
Par exemple, mysqld :
[root@www mysql-5.1.59]#cp support-files/mysql.server etc/init.d/mysqld chkconfig mysqld on
(chaque niveau est ON, chaque niveau est le niveau 2345) Ce démarrera en tant que service système.
5. Supprimer le service :
chkconfig –del XXX
runlevel Afficher le niveau actuel.
Remarque : Le niveau d'exécution est le niveau fonctionnel auquel le système d'exploitation s'exécute.
Articles et tutoriels connexes recommandés : tutoriel Linux
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!